How to read a Audi Q5 e VIN — every digit explained

Every Audi Q5 e carries a unique 17-character VIN stamped at the factory. Each position is a code — together they spell out where, when and how your car was built. Here's exactly what every digit means.

FIG.02·How to Read a Audi Q5 e VIN
1–3 · WMIWA1
4–8 · VDSCM826
9 · Check5
10 · YearR
11 · PlantA
12–17 · Serial004352
  • WMI (1–3) — country & manufacturer. Tells you it's a Audi and the country it was built in (real Audi codes below).
  • VDS (4–8) — model, body style, engine, trim & restraints. The 8th digit is the engine code.
  • Check digit (9) — a math check that proves the VIN is genuine.
  • Model year (10) — the year it was built (e.g. R = 2024, S = 2025).
  • Plant (11) — which factory assembled this Q5 e.
  • Serial (12–17) — the unique sequential production number.

What MPG does the Audi Q5 e get?

The Audi Q5 e returns up to 32 combined MPG (EPA), which works out to roughly $1,950/yr in fuel. Pick an engine to see MPG, annual running cost and CO₂ by year:

The 2025 Audi Q5 e (2L 4-cyl) gets 28 mpg combined and costs about $2,750/yr to fuel, emitting 320 g/mi CO₂ (GHG 6/10, smog 6/10) — about $2,750 more than the average new vehicle over 5 years.

FIG.05a·Audi Q5 e MPG, CO₂ & smog — 4-cyl
YearCityHwyCombFuel/yrCO₂ g/miSmogEngine
2025 Q5 e243428$2,7503206/102L 4-cyl
2020 Q5 e273630$2,1002937/102L 4-cyl
ROWS 2·SOURCE EPA (ForCar database)

The 2024 Audi Q5 e (2L 4-cyl Hybrid) gets 32 mpg combined and costs about $1,950/yr to fuel, emitting 279 g/mi CO₂ (GHG 6/10, smog 7/10) — that's about $1,250 saved over 5 years versus the average new vehicle.

FIG.05b·Audi Q5 e MPG, CO₂ & smog — Hybrid
YearCityHwyCombFuel/yrCO₂ g/miSmogEngine
2024 Q5 e293732$1,9502797/102L 4-cyl Hybrid
2023 Q5 e283832$1,9502767/102L 4-cyl Hybrid
2021 Q5 e243026$2,9503355/102L 4-cyl Hybrid
ROWS 3·SOURCE EPA (ForCar database)

Source: EPA fuel-economy database (ForCar-hosted, 1986–2027) — best combined rating per engine & year, with EPA annual fuel cost and tailpipe CO₂. Trim & drivetrain vary slightly; decode your VIN for the exact figure.

How much does a Audi Q5 e cost to own?

A Audi Q5 e tends to depreciate faster than average. A typical example keeps roughly 37% of its value after five years — losing about 63% to depreciation. Check what a used Q5 e is worth today or browse current used-market prices before you buy or sell. Fuel, maintenance and insurance add to the total cost to own.

75%
Value @ 1 yr
53%
Value @ 3 yrs
37%
Value @ 5 yrs
$9,750
Est. 5-yr fuel
FIG.08·Audi Q5 e Depreciation & Resale
$
AgeValue retainedEst. resale valueLost to depreciation
Year 175%$22,500−$7,500
Year 263%$18,900−$11,100
Year 353%$15,900−$14,100
Year 444%$13,200−$16,800
Year 537%$11,100−$18,900
ROWS 5·SOURCE ForCar estimate

What goes into the five-year cost to own:

  • Depreciation — the biggest cost: this Q5 e loses about 63% of its value over five years. See the full depreciation curve by age.
  • Fuel — ≈ $9,750 over five years at roughly 15,000 miles a year.
  • Maintenance & repairs — routine service, tires and wear items as the Q5 e ages.
  • Insurance — varies by driver, state and trim; get a quote for your exact figure.

Resale & depreciation are ForCar estimates from typical segment value-retention curves — not a live market quote. Fuel from EPA fueleconomy.gov at ~15k mi/yr.
